In 1843, Jacob Wesley Mann entered the world in Orange, Rush, Indiana, born to John William Mann and Nancy Power. Years later, Jacob Wesley Mann married Mary Ann Sherman, and the couple became parents to Emma May Mann, Charles Franklin Mann, George Ernest Mann, Minnie Ann Mann, Nellie Beatrice Mann, Daniel Wesley Mann and Clay Clarence Mann. Jacob Wesley Mann died in 1925 in Spirit Lake, Kootenai, Idaho.
